Description
FULL DESCRIPTION Rare residential redevelopment opportunity set within approximately 6.68 acres near Kenilworth. Occupying an established residential site within private grounds, this unique property offers exceptional potential for redevelopment. A planning application has been submitted for the erection of a bespoke replacement self-build dwelling, subject to the outcome of the application. The property comprises a spacious 1950s residence together with an extensive range of outbuildings, stables and barns, all benefiting from separate access via Crackley Lane. The combination of generous acreage, established residential use, private setting and independent access offers outstanding scope for redevelopment, refurbishment or reconfiguration to create a home tailored to a purchaser's own requirements.
BIRCHES WOOD FARM Birches Wood is situated on Crackley Lane a short drive from Kenilworth and Coventry. The property is a detached dwelling, the original dating from 1952, with several later additions added in order to provide the large and spacious property it is now. The house is in need of full renovation and refurbishment therefore providing a prospective buyer with a superb opportunity to create their own individual 'Self Build' home. The property is well suited to a buyer looking to create a distinctive home with the option of, and land for, equestrian activities, nature conservation and rewilding or a home with a delightful parkland setting to the main house. There are many different options available.
GARDENS AND LAND The property sits on an 6.68 acre plot being well screened from the lane by mature trees including Beech, Lime and Oak trees. There is a large expanse of lawned areas, a wildlife pond and orchard having previously had soft fruit planting. There is a mature woodland to two boundaries with bluebells and other woodland flowers. To the north of the property is the construction of HS2 which will be in a deep cutting passing under Crackley Lane with additional screening and young tree planting is due to take place.
PARKING There is a garage with driveway parking to the front of the existing dwelling.
LOCATION Local amenities are within easy reach to include Kenilworth Tennis, Squash and Croquet Club, Crackley Wood Nature Reserve, The Greenway cycle and footpath to Burton Green, Kenilworth and Warwick University and plenty of open countryside. Kenilworth itself is approximately two miles away and a short drive where the wide variety of shops, bistros and restaurants plus parks, Castle and sought after schools for children of all ages will be found. For commuting Coventry and Tile Hill train stations are again within a few minutes drive away, this offers a main line Avanti service to Birmingham and London Euston. Birmingham International Airport is handy too again that is an approximate twenty minute drive. For commuters who drive the local motorway and arterial networks to include the A46 and A45, M40 and M42 can be reached easily.
SCHOOLS There is ample choice within the area for schools for children of all ages including both the Independent and State sector. These schools are all within Kenilworth, Balsall Common, Burton Green and Coventry.
SERVICES Mains water and electricity are connected to the property. LPG gas supply. Private drainage.
PLANNING APPLICATION SUBMITTED A planning application has been submitted for the demolition of the existing dwelling and erection of replacement self-build dwelling and the installation of a package sewage treatment plant. The details can be found on Warwick District Council's Planning Portal, the reference number is: W/26/0442
